Packages, which is subscribed to linux in Ubuntu.
https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1878351
Title:
System shutdown directly by pressing
The shutdown is caused by the commit of
https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=688076.
gnome-session-bin handle the first shutdown request, and change to
QUERY_END_SESSION_PHASE, but the second shutdown request arrive before
it open the endSessionDialog, and user not yet confirm to shutdown.
